Output ec7227b4e860fe43114d40b7cc1af4a51b240775425ef73231f77538cafcdaf2:0

value
1514000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 085363af0e1b22e264fe985d88009ddd9426d09f OP_EQUAL
address
32T3E5HpRyq3WdHcBsXBfEyvfej92q2ipj
transaction
ec7227b4e860fe43114d40b7cc1af4a51b240775425ef73231f77538cafcdaf2
spent
true